The Chemistry Behind Bimatoprost



Bimatoprost is a synthetic prostamide, an analogue of prostaglandin F2α, designed to mimic the body's natural compounds. Its unique structure incorporates an amide linkage instead of the usual ester linkage, enabling its stability and efficacy. The molecular configuration allows bimatoprost to bind effectively to prostaglandin receptors, enhancing its performance in reducing intraocular pressure.

In its elixir form, bimatoprost functions by increasing the outflow of aqueous humor through both the trabecular meshwork and uveoscleral pathways. This dual mechanism achieves potent results in glaucoma management, making it a staple script in ophthalmology. Bimatoprost's Mechanism of Action in Glaucoma Treatment


Bimatoprost lowers intraocular pressure by increasing the outflow of aqueous humor through the trabecular meshwork and uveoscleral pathways. By activating prostaglandin receptors in the eye, this comp medication enhances fluid drainage, reducing pressure buildup, which is crucial for preventing optic nerve damage in glaucoma patients. How Bimatoprost Promotes Eyelash Growth



Bimatoprost is integrated into cosmetic and medical formulations due to its ability to stimulate eyelash growth. When applied to the base of the upper lashes, the compound interacts with prostaglandin receptors, prolonging the growth phase of the hair follicle cycle. This leads to thicker and longer eyelashes over time, offering a natural boost without the need for extensions. Potential Side Effects and Precautions


Bimatoprost, while highly effective for glaucoma and eyelash growth, comes with possible side effects that users should be aware of. The most common issues include eye redness, itching, and changes in eyelash color or length. Less frequently, it may lead to more serious problems like blurred vision or eye pain.
